Transaction ab7d63056edaf4fe6b13fbaea29e6b8f4b4fd41c499734395ca1350372473920

1 Input
2 Outputs
  • ab7d63056edaf4fe6b13fbaea29e6b8f4b4fd41c499734395ca1350372473920:0
  • value  23810000
    address  17N9w4j36cz77hA6CXh96yUiLn3eeSHEra
  • ab7d63056edaf4fe6b13fbaea29e6b8f4b4fd41c499734395ca1350372473920:1
  • value  3053896810
    address  16gxb5PQv8V7fddr33Ww1sfwm9kB7gT2hB